In 1939, the British restricted Jewish Immigration into Palestine by enforcing a policy known as "The White Paper." A Jewish underground organization known as the Irgun, fought furiously against them. After the Holocaust ended in 1945, the British continued to restrict Jews from entering the country and the Irgun renewed their fight against the British. The Girl from Babylon tells the fascinating story of one of the Irgun's surviving members, Adina-Hay Nissan. Adina served the Irgun as a messenger and played a vital role in some of the most historic missions in early Israeli history, including the infamous bombing of the King David Hotel.
